An array is sorted (in ascending order) if each element of the array is less than or equal to the next element .

An array of size 0 or 1 is sorted

Compare the first two elements of the array ; if they are out of order, the array is not sorted; otherwise, check the if the rest of the array is sorted.

Write a boolean -valued  method  named  isSorted that accepts an integer  array , and the number of elements in the array and returns whether the array is sorted.

Solution

SortCheck.java


public class SortCheck {

  
   public static void main(String[] args) {
       System.out.println(isSorted(new int[]{1,2,3,4,5}, 5));
       System.out.println(isSorted(new int[]{1,2,4,3,5}, 5));
   }
   public static boolean isSorted(int a[], int size){
       if(size ==0 || size == 1){
           return true;
       }
       for(int i=0; i<size-1; i++){
           if(a[i] > a[i+1])
               return false;
       }
       return true;
   }

}

Output:

true
false
